About
Conducts 2ND Level Formulary/UM Claim Research
Implementation clinical coding support for BDS/cBDT/RxConstruct questions
GPI Reclass support/global Coding Change Support Drug utilization management
Commercial clinical audit support
Manage custom formulary coding work post client sign off
Translate client intent to code-able language for BOM team
Evaluate / resolve new rule design & conflicts with existing formulary coding
New Client Implementation coding support for custom formulary/UM programs
Extracts, evaluates and interprets clinical coding in adjudication & formulary management systems

Required Qualifications: Bachelor of Science in Pharmacy or PharmD
Current and unrestricted Pharmacist license (any U.S. state)
2+ years of experience working as a Clinical Consultant or Clinical pharmacist working in Formulary/UM operations or Benefit administration
Experience conducting claims/coding research and analysis
Experience working within a PBM
Experience working in RX Claim or other claims adjudication system
Ability to navigate MS Office and a Windows based environment and the ability to create, edit, save, and send documents utilizing Microsoft Word; ability to navigate Outlook and conduct Internet searches
Intermediate to Advanced Proficiency with Microsoft Excel
Preferred Qualifications: MBA or other related advanced business degree
Experience using Microsoft Access or other database/query tools
Experience with Medi-Span drug classification system
Client-facing experience (beyond patients and prescribers)
